After a momentous year for ReNeuron catalysed by the clinical results from their hRPC program for retinitis pigmentosa (RP), the H1’20 financial results brought the year to a positive close. A strong cash position enables the expansion of both of its clinical programs and notably the scale of the hRPC program has been expanded in order to accelerate the product’s regulatory approval. Further clinical data on the hRPC program is expected in 2020 before the first pivotal study on the CTX program in chronic stroke reads-out in H1’21.
